CSS (Cascading Style Sheets)選擇器是用來(lái)選擇HTML(超文本標(biāo)記語(yǔ)言)文檔中某些元素的一種方法。通過(guò)選取HTML文檔中的元素,可以為它們?cè)O(shè)置不同的樣式。CSS選擇器非常實(shí)用,可以幫助開(kāi)發(fā)者快速而簡(jiǎn)單地修改網(wǎng)頁(yè)內(nèi)容的樣式。
使用CSS選擇器的基本語(yǔ)法如下: selector { property: value; property2: value2; }
其中,selector是用來(lái)選取HTML文檔中需要設(shè)置樣式的元素的標(biāo)識(shí)符,property是需要設(shè)置的樣式屬性,value是屬性的值。例如:
p { color: blue; font-size: 16px; }
上面的代碼將會(huì)把網(wǎng)頁(yè)中的所有p標(biāo)簽的字體顏色設(shè)置為藍(lán)色,字體大小設(shè)置為16px。
CSS選擇器有很多種,每一種都可以根據(jù)不同的規(guī)則和方式來(lái)選取HTML文檔中的元素。一些常用的選擇器包括:
- 元素選擇器:
p { ... }
- 類選擇器:
.class { ... }
- id選擇器:
#id { ... }
- 后代選擇器:
div p { ... }
- 偽類選擇器:
a:hover { ... }
元素選擇器選取HTML文檔中所有指定的元素,類選擇器選取帶有指定類名的元素,id選擇器選取帶有指定id的元素,后代選擇器選取嵌套在指定元素內(nèi)部的元素,偽類選擇器選取一些特定狀態(tài)的元素,比如鏈接在鼠標(biāo)懸浮時(shí)的狀態(tài)。
對(duì)于開(kāi)發(fā)者來(lái)說(shuō),熟練掌握CSS選擇器的使用是十分重要的。通過(guò)靈活運(yùn)用不同的選擇器,可以為HTML文檔中的元素設(shè)置非常豐富、詳細(xì)的樣式。